"Going forward, we hope that the two sides will follow the important consensus reached by the two leaders and translate it into concerted actions taken by all departments and in all fields, so as to bring China-India relations back to the track of sound and steady development at an early date," noted Ma.

"We hope to firmly stick to the correct direction of China-India relations. China and India are eternal neighbors who need to accurately understand each other's strategic intentions and to support and contribute to each other's success instead of undermining and doubting each other. We need to jointly oppose zero-sum games and keep our region away from geopolitical calculations."

"We hope to properly manage and handle differences and sensitive issues," she continued. "Many of the problems in China-India relations are left over from history and will take time to resolve."

She stressed that China and India have the ability and wisdom to find a way for friendly coexistence between neighboring major countries and jointly create the "Asian Century". Both sides hope to accelerate the resumption of practical cooperation and deepen it, Ma said.

There are complementarities between India and China as the two countries are both part of the Global South, she noted.

The theme of India's hosting of the recent G20 Summit in New Delhi was "One Earth, One Family, One Future", which is highly consistent with President Xi's vision of building a community with a shared future for mankind.

"We are ready to work with people from all walks of life who care about and support China-India relations, and promote the stability, improvement, and development of bilateral relations for the benefit of the two countries and two peoples," Ma said toward the end of her speech.
